For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public school serving 984 students in Beta Academy School District.
Public Schools in Beta Academy School District have a diversity score of 0.57, which is less than the Texas public school average of 0.64.
Minority enrollment is 70%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Texas public school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$15,517 is higher than the state median of $13,387. The school district revenue/student has grown by 22%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$10,671 is less than the state median of $14,116. The school district spending/student has grown by 22% over four school years.

Teachers in 19 States Allowed to Physically Punish Students
Teachers in 19 States Allowed to Physically Punish Students
As of 2014, nineteen states still allow corporal punishment – spanking and paddling the most common choices – in their public schools. However, some argue that not only are these punishments physically harmful, they also are disproportionately administered to students of color. As a result, House democrats have taken up the issue in a new bill that would ban all forms of corporal punishment nationwide.
